1. What is Triangle Area Calculation?

The triangle area calculation determines the square footage of a triangular space using the base and height measurements. This is essential for various applications including construction, landscaping, and interior design.

2. How Does the Calculator Work?

The calculator uses the triangle area formula:

\[ Area = \frac{Base \times Height}{2} \]

Explanation: The formula calculates the area by multiplying the base and height, then dividing by two, as a triangle is essentially half of a parallelogram.

5.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: Can I use different units of measurement?
A: This calculator uses feet as the standard unit. Convert all measurements to feet before calculation for accurate results.

Q2: What if my triangle isn't a right triangle?
A: The formula works for all triangles as long as you use the perpendicular height from the base to the opposite vertex.

Q3: How accurate should my measurements be?
A: For most practical purposes, measurements to the nearest 1/4 inch (0.02 feet) are sufficient.

Q4: Can I calculate area with three sides instead of base and height?
A: This calculator uses the base-height method. For three-side calculations, you would need Heron's formula instead.

Q5: Why divide by 2 in the formula?
A: A triangle is half of a parallelogram with the same base and height, hence the division by two.
